Psychiatric Residential Treatment Facility

Devereux Colorado’s psychiatric residential treatment program serves children and adolescents, ages 9 to 17, with significant emotional and behavioral challenges.

We provide long-term, therapeutic and educational support for youth at our licensed psychiatric residential treatment facility in Westminster, Colo.

The individuals who enter into our care have not responded to treatment in lower levels of care or existing facilities, or have been unable to access appropriate placements. Our highly skilled team of behavioral health professionals provide one-on-one support to help youth achieve their social, emotional and educational goals.

Providing individualized care

Devereux Colorado staff work closely with youth and families to develop treatment plans that build on each individual’s strengths, needs and preferences. All services are provided using an evidence-based, family-focused and collaborative approach.

Our treatment team is comprised of the following:

  • Unit manager
  • Psychiatrist
  • Master’s-level clinician
  • Case coordinator
  • Direct support professionals
  • Nursing staff
  • Dietary staff

We offer a full continuum of care, including individual, group and family therapy, as well as educational and recreational services.
